A 26 year old employee of the Louis Armstrong International Airport in New Orleans endured a tragic death recently while unloading a series of baggage from a Frontier Airlines flight!
According to USA Today news, the incident occurred Tuesday August 30th around 10:20 PM as Jermani Thompson was unloading baggage. She worked as ground support for the the company GAT.
In a direct statement from the company’s CEO Mike Hough reveals that Jermani’s hair had gotten entangled in the machinery of the belt loader. “We are heartbroken and are supporting her family and her friends as best as we are able.”
Jermani is said to have been rushed to Ochsner Medical Center-Kenner where she was sadly pronounced dead. An autopsy to determine the official cause of the incident hasn’t been scheduled as of yet.
Reports read that Frontier Airlines had canceled a single flight Wednesday morning after the accident, however all other flights proceeded on schedule.
“We extend our deepest condolences following the tragic death of a team member of our ground handling business partner at Louis Armstrong International Airport in New Orleans,” says Jennifer de la Cruz said in a forwarded statement. “Our thoughts are with her family and loved ones during this difficult time.”
In an interview with nola.com, Jermani’s mother Angela Dorsey stated, “She was my baby girl. Everybody loved her, she loved basketball. I’m just lost for words. I can’t even think.
“She was the sweetest person. She was a hard worker who always went after her goals,” said, Nichole Branch, Jermani’s sister-in-law.
“She was the kind of kid who was always smiling, a great teammate. She wasn’t the biggest or the tallest. But whenever she went on the floor, she gave me everything she had. There was no quit in her, no matter what the score was.” said Jermani’s former coach Daniel Harrison.
